Questions and Answers

Can I have a smart gate for my pool?

Yes, if it integrates with mandated safety hardware. An IoT-enabled latch must still comply with IRC Appendix AG, requiring a self-closing, self-latching mechanism operable from the pool side. Modern systems combine access logs with this physical standard for Ohio liability coverage.

How deep do fence posts need to be in Manchester, OH?

Posts require a minimum 36-inch footing depth to surpass the 32-inch frost line. The IRC mandates this to prevent frost heave, which lifts posts and fails fences. In Manchester Village Center, posts set shallower than 32 inches will fail within two winters.

What are the fence height and placement rules in Manchester?

Zoning limits are 4 feet in front yards and 6 feet in rear and side yards, with a 0-foot setback on the property line. For corner lots, maintain a clear 'sight triangle' at intersections. Lots near US-52 require strict adherence to visibility rules for traffic safety.

Is a standard fence strong enough for Manchester's wind?

No. A 115 MPH V-ult wind load rating dictates structural design. This requires engineered post spacing, concrete footings, and wind-rated brackets to resist uplift. Fences not built to ASCE 7-22 standards for this rating will likely fail during peak storm season gusts.

Do I need to notify my neighbor before building a fence in Manchester?

Yes, for any shared or boundary fence. Ohio Revised Code Section 971.01, the 'Good Neighbor Fence Law,' requires written notice to adjacent property owners before repair or replacement. As of 2026, this is a mandatory step before obtaining a Manchester permit for a partition fence.

What fence materials work best with Manchester's soil?

Select materials for moderate soil corrosivity and termite risk. Use pressure-treated wood rated for ground contact or vinyl. For metal posts and fasteners, specify hot-dip galvanized steel to prevent rust streaks. Aluminum is a suitable low-corrosion alternative.

What are the first steps before digging fence post holes?

First, call Ohio 811 for a utility locate. Hitting a line in Manchester Village Center incurs major liability and repair costs. Second, file for a permit with the Manchester permit office. We manage both steps, including the site plan showing the fence relative to property lines.
